use crate::routes::ApiError; use crate::routes::v3::project_creation::CreateError; use crate::util::validate::validation_errors_to_string; use actix_multipart::Field; use actix_web::web::Payload; use bytes::BytesMut; use futures::StreamExt; use serde::de::DeserializeOwned; use validator::Validate; pub async fn read_limited_from_payload( payload: &mut Payload, cap: usize, err_msg: &'static str, ) -> Result { let mut bytes = BytesMut::new(); while let Some(item) = payload.next().await { if bytes.len() >= cap { return Err(ApiError::InvalidInput(String::from(err_msg))); } else { bytes.extend_from_slice(&item.map_err(|_| { ApiError::InvalidInput( "Unable to parse bytes in payload sent!".to_string(), ) })?); } } Ok(bytes) } pub async fn read_typed_from_payload( payload: &mut Payload, ) -> Result where T: DeserializeOwned + Validate, { let mut bytes = BytesMut::new(); while let Some(item) = payload.next().await { bytes.extend_from_slice(&item.map_err(|_| { ApiError::InvalidInput( "Unable to parse bytes in payload sent!".to_string(), ) })?); } let parsed: T = serde_json::from_slice(&bytes)?; parsed.validate().map_err(|err| { ApiError::InvalidInput(validation_errors_to_string(err, None)) })?; Ok(parsed) } pub async fn read_from_field( field: &mut Field, cap: usize, err_msg: &'static str, ) -> Result { let mut bytes = BytesMut::new(); while let Some(chunk) = field.next().await { let chunk = chunk?; if bytes.len().saturating_add(chunk.len()) > cap { return Err(CreateError::InvalidInput(String::from(err_msg))); } bytes.extend_from_slice(&chunk); } Ok(bytes) }
